Output 21421bec2d9163f9cc5386b0cea7eaa018d74a73f06f0fe706730e212c304ba3:9

value
19029591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2449c05d69d36c39e7c5135445744e1cf975a602 OP_EQUAL
address
MBD2ug6oFwJrrDXeSp8StbPJLBoYFY7DYK
transaction
21421bec2d9163f9cc5386b0cea7eaa018d74a73f06f0fe706730e212c304ba3
spent
true